Description
This cookie has a chewy bottom crust with a sweet cream cheese layer on top. I like this best with a yellow or lemon cake mix.
Ingredients
- 1 (18.25 ounce) package yellow cake mix
- ½ cup butter, melted
- 1 egg, beaten
- 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 3 ½ cups confectioners’ sugar
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our a 15×10-inch sheet pan.
- Make the cake mix layer: Stir cake mix
- melted butter
- and egg in a bowl until well combined. Press mixture into the prepared sheet pan.
- Make the cream cheese layer: Beat cream cheese and eggs in a bowl until combined. Gradually mix in confectioners’ sugar. Pour mixture over the cake mix layer in the sheet pan.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es. Reduce the oven temperature to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C)
- and continue to bake until a toothpick inserted at the center of the pan comes out with just a few moist crumbs clinging to it
- 30 to 35 minutes more.
- Remove from the oven and let cool completely before cutting into 24 bars.
Servings: 12
